Improvement of Illumination of Goods Shed - South Western Railway Bangalore
-
Objective
The project focused on improving the illumination of the goods shed at South Western Railway, Bangalore, by providing reliable and high-performance lighting infrastructure.
-
Challenges
The project required adherence to specific requirements laid out by the Railway Authority. It demanded compliance with Railway-approved drawings and technical data sheets (TDS), along with timely delivery and quality assurance. Final inspections were conducted by RITES, adding an additional layer of scrutiny to the project.
-
Solutions
Utkarsh India produced 28 high masts of 20 MTRS each at its state-of-the-art production unit. Key actions included:
- Ensuring the materials met all Railway Authority specifications and approved drawings.
- Conducting a single, efficient inspection by the RITES inspector, clearing all quality checks seamlessly.
- Coordinating production and logistics to ensure timely delivery within the project’s stipulated timeline.
